WGH, Hs{Lord Ernest Hives - Chair}, Hsy, HJG.[/Strikethrough] 20/25 Dashboard and Spare Wheel Carrier Stays. -------------------------------------------- Herewith is N. Sch.4174 showing the strengthened lug on the engine support bracket and the double stay to the dashboard, with larger bolt. The new stay requires to be narrower than the existing one, and it is suggested that it might replace it when convenient, on both sides. Da.{Bernard Day - Chassis Design} | ||
